Vegetation greenesss data for the Aït Benhaddou Catchment, Morocco. Includes: 1984-2019 NDVI time series, breakpoint analysis results, and resillience indicator results, among others.
<p>This dataset is comprised of two main parts, both originating from different but related works. </p> <p>The NDVI timeseries and breakpoint analysis were originally developed by Vermeer (2021) for the MSc thesis: Vermeer, A. L. (2021). <em>Ecological stability in the face of climatic disturbances: a case study of a dryland ecosystem in the Moroccan High Atlas Mountains</em>. These data include a harmonized timeseries of Normalized Difference Vegetation Index from different Landsat missions at 30x30 meter resolution for the Aït Benhaddou catchment in Morocco. It also includes the output of a breakpoint analysis that was conducted using this dataset, which showcases different statistical breakpoints in NDVI after a severe drought that occured between 1998 and 2002. Shapefiles, a DEM and masks of irrigiated areas for the catchment are also included. For more information about these data, consult Vermeer (2021).</p> <p>The secondary part of this dataset was produced by Grootoonk (2024) for the MSc thesis: Grootoonk, W. (2024). <em>Relations between temporal resilience indicators and trend breakpoints in a dryland high-mountain catchment, </em>drawing upon the original dataset from Vermeer (2021). These data include Kendall's tau values for the resillience indicators variance and lag-one autocorrelation, computed using a rolling window for each pixel. Results for differerent window sizes (WS) for both indicators are included. </p> <p>Beyond these main results, a number of additional data sources are provided. These are Kendall's tau for precipitation variance in the area, produced using CHIRPS data (https://www.chc.ucsb.edu/data/chirps) and a NSI soil salinity map produced from Landsat imagery. See Grootoonk (2024) for more information. </p>

A Comparative Analysis of Machine Learning Approaches to Gap Filling Meteorological Datasets (Results Only)
<p>This dataset contains the results from our evaluation of methodologies for filling gaps in meterological data. Variables were chosen to represent a standard set of measurements for purposes typically performed using Weather Stations installed in urban and rural areas. There are 4 dimensions by which we measure and validate each of the gap filling models across a large set of experimental configurations: meteorological variables <strong>TargetVar </strong>(dewpoint, humidity, leaf wetness, temp); <strong>feature_set</strong> (AWS, AWS-ERA5, ERA5, ERA5_Debias, Spatial); 3 types of machine learning algorithms <strong>ML</strong> (linear regression, random forests, LightGBM) combined with 2 non-ML algorithms; and <strong>gap_length</strong>: 1, 4, 36 and 288. A total of 1,720 experiments were conducted: 1,440 machine learning experiments; 160 using a spatial algorithm and 120 experiments using ERA5. For the 3 machine learning experiments, the average result was selected for each of 10 sites for 4 gap sizes (40 results) with the 3 ML models using 3 different feature sets (120 results).</p> <p>Data is provided in both CSV format and as a MySQL dump.</p> <p>Resultsets are accompanied with the SQL expression used to generate the result.</p>

Analysis of the water-power nexus of the Balkan Peninsula power system - results
<p>Power generation sector worldwide accounts for high water withdrawal and consumption due to the hydropower generation and cooling of thermal power plants. Hence, the operation of the power generation sector is constrained by the availability of the water resources, as well as the addition of constrains on water resources used for other purposes, such as irrigation, flood control, water supply, agriculture, etc. The optimal utilization of water resources between the water and energy sector is defined under the term water-energy (or water-power) nexus. This study describes the implementation of hydrological LISFLOOD, Medium-Term Hydrothermal Coordination (DispaSET-MTHC) and Unit Commitment and Dispatch (DispaSET UCD) models for detailed analysis of impacts on the SEE regional power system for three different hydrological years. Results were validated based on the available ENTSO-E data for the average hydrological (2015) year. Moreover, calculations on water withdrawal and consumption for cooling of thermal power plants were added. Addition of water stress index (WSI) calculations can determine locations that could experience water scarcity.</p> <p>This dataset is composed of results of the latter described study.</p> <p>Results are divided into three sets, as results from the first model DispaSET MTHC (MTHC_results_Balkan), second model DispaSET UCD (UCD_results_Balkan) and additional calculations on water consumption and withdrawal for thermal power plant cooling (Water_relazed_results_Balkan).</p>
